@import 'https://fonts.googleapis.com/css?family=Open+Sans:300,400,600,700,800';@import url(https://fonts.googleapis.com/css?family=Cinzel+Decorative:400,900);article,aside,details,figcaption,figure,footer,header,hgroup,nav,section{display:block}audio,canvas,video{display:inline-block;*display:inline;*zoom:1}audio:not([controls]){display:none}.wp-float-left{float:left;margin:0 20px 20px 0}.wp-float-right{float:right;margin:0 0 20px 20px}#map_canvas img,.google-maps img{max-width:none}#recaptcha_table td{line-height:0}.recaptchatable #recaptcha_response_field{min-height:0;line-height:12px}.shadow{box-shadow:0 5px 45px 5px rgba(0,0,0,0.13)}.offset{background:#f7f7fa}.text-left{text-align:left}.text-center{text-align:center}.text-right{text-align:right}.section-padding{margin-top:2em;margin-bottom:2em}.middle-wrapper{font-size:0}.middle{font-size:1rem;display:inline-block !important;vertical-align:middle;float:none !important}.container{margin-left:auto !important;margin-right:auto !important;padding:0 30px;max-width:1200px;float:none !important}a{color:#fbb400;text-decoration:none}h1,h2,h3,h4,h5,h6,p{margin:1rem 0}.section{padding:70px 0 !important}.hero{background-repeat:no-repeat;background-position:center center;-webkit-background-size:cover;-moz-background-size:cover;-o-background-size:cover;background-size:cover}.hero img{max-height:50px;width:auto !important;margin:0}.hero h1{font-size:30px;font-weight:800;line-height:1.3;margin:2rem 0}.hero p{font-weight:500;font-size:14px}.hero ul{margin-top:2rem;padding-left:20px;margin-left:0}.hero li{font-size:18px;font-weight:400}.form-wrapper{background:#fff;padding:20px;padding-top:30px;color:#1f3045;box-shadow:rgba(0,0,0,.2) 0px 10px 20px -8px}.form-wrapper h3{margin:0;color:#fbb400}.form-wrapper p{font-size:13px;font-weight:500}.form{text-align:left;font-size:12px;font-weight:500}.form input[type="text"],.hero .form input[type="password"],.hero .form input[type="email"],.hero .form input[type="tel"],textarea,.hero .form select{text-align:left;width:100% !important;display:block;margin-bottom:10px;padding:10px;border:1px solid #c4d5e9;font-size:14px;border-radius:4px;height:40px;background:#fff;color:#1f3045;font-weight:500}textarea{height:150px}.form .hs-form-required{display:none}.form ul,.hero .form ol{list-style:none !important;padding-left:0}.form input[type="checkbox"],.hero .form input[type="radio"]{margin-right:10px;width:auto !important;display:inline}.form .hs-button{padding:15px 10px;background:#fbb400;color:#fff;display:block;margin-top:14px;text-align:center;font-size:16px;border:0;display:block;width:100%;border-radius:4px;font-weight:900}.features{text-align:center}.features img{max-width:50px}.switchback{background:#337ab7;color:#fff}.solutions{text-align:center}.solutions img{margin:0}.solutions .solution-text{border:1px solid #eee;border-top:0;padding:10px 20px}.solutions h3{font-weight:900;font-size:16px;color:#fbb400}.solutions p{font-size:12px;font-weight:500}.testimonials p{font-weight:500;font-size:14px}.testimonials .testimonial img{margin:0}.testimonials .testimonial em{opacity:.6;font-size:14px}.cta{background-repeat:no-repeat;background-position:center center;-webkit-background-size:cover;-moz-background-size:cover;-o-background-size:cover;background-size:cover}.cta h2{font-size:30px;font-weight:800;line-height:1.3;margin:2rem 0}.cta p{font-weight:500;font-size:14px}.cta a{margin:1.5rem 0}@media(max-width:767px){.container{padding:0 20px}.section{padding:30px 0px}}